054b9e5beb fix(articles): import-projection accepts F3 + legacy field_meta shapes
Live-test caught it: the worker projects sync_changes via field-level
LWW, comparing `field_meta[k]` directly. But field_meta is two-shaped
on the wire:

  - Legacy plaintext writes:   { state: '2026-04-28T…' }
  - Field-meta-overhaul writes: { state: { at, actor, origin } }

The naive `rowFM[k] >= localTime` worked for the all-legacy case, but
once a client write (legacy string) followed a worker write (F3
object), the comparison evaluated `'2026-04-28T…' >= '[object …]'`
and the projection silently kept the older value. Live symptom: an
item that was correctly flipped to 'saved' on the client was reported
back as 'extracted' by the projection.

Fix: `fieldMetaTime()` helper that pulls the ISO string out of either
shape; both write paths now compare apples-to-apples.

91fd88e77d fix(picture): normalize Try-On refs to clean RGB PNG before OpenAI call
gpt-image-1 answered the last Try-On attempt with
  invalid_image_file: Invalid image file or mode for image 2
because one of the references (face/body/garment) was in a format or
color mode OpenAI's edits endpoint rejects — typical culprits are
HEIC from iPhones, CMYK JPEG, palette-mode PNG, APNG, or JPEG with an
ICC profile gpt-image-1 doesn't honour. mana-media stores originals
verbatim so whatever the user uploaded is what we were forwarding.

Route the references through mana-media's existing on-the-fly
/transform endpoint (format=png, w/h=1024, fit=inside) which pipes
the buffer through sharp server-side. One call per ref, all run in
parallel, same latency budget as before. Output is guaranteed
- PNG / RGB (or RGBA if the source had alpha, which gpt-image-1 accepts),
- no more than 1024 px on the longest side → well under OpenAI's
  4 MB/image cap,
- aspect-ratio-preserving (fit=inside) so a portrait body photo
  doesn't get squished into a square.

New helper `getMediaBufferAsPng(mediaId, longestSide)` in lib/media.ts
encapsulates the transform-URL build. The Try-On path in the picture
route now uses it instead of `getMediaBuffer`; all Blob filenames
pin to `.png` since the buffer is already normalized.

b204958007 feat(picture): fall back to gpt-image-1 when gpt-image-2 org-unverified
OpenAI started gating gpt-image-2 behind per-organization verification
(platform.openai.com/settings/organization/general → Verify Organization,
propagation up to 15 min). Unverified orgs get:

  "Your organization must be verified to use the model gpt-image-2"

Keeps Try-On broken until the user completes that manual step. Since
the edits endpoint is identical across gpt-image-1 and gpt-image-2
(same image[] multi-ref, same size/quality/n params), detect that
specific rejection and retry once with gpt-image-1.

- buildFormData(modelName) + callOpenAiEdits(modelName) extracted so
  the retry is a one-line re-invoke with the fallback model instead
  of a duplicated fetch block.
- needsGptImage1Fallback() matches /verified to use the model/i in
  the error body AND checks the attempted model was actually
  gpt-image-2 — an explicit openai/gpt-image-1 request stays on 1.
- Response now reports `model: openai/${modelUsed}` so the
  picture.images row records whichever model actually produced the
  image (matters for future re-generation / audit).

Credits unchanged: our flat 3/10/25-per-quality tariff applies to all
openai/* paths. Slight over-charge for the gpt-image-1 fallback until
the user verifies, then gpt-image-2 takes over automatically.

15beddeda9 fix(picture): use image[] array syntax for multi-ref gpt-image-2 edits
The try-on path POST'd N reference images as repeated `image` fields in
the multipart body. OpenAI's edits endpoint answers that with
`duplicate_parameter: Duplicate parameter: 'image'. You provided
multiple values for this parameter, whereas only one is allowed. If
you are trying to provide a list of values, use the array syntax
instead e.g. 'image[]=<value>'.`

Switch to the array-syntax field name `image[]`, which OpenAI accepts
for cardinality ≥ 1 (no branching needed for the single-ref case).

Also surface the underlying error from the three 502 branches
(ownership-check, media-fetch, OpenAI call) into both the server log
(structured console.error with refIds + openai body) and the response
`detail` field. The client's callGenerateWithReference now prepends
`detail` to the thrown message so the user sees the concrete reason
in-module instead of a generic "Try-On fehlgeschlagen (502)".

76d11a84ee feat(auth): server-side tier gating via requireTier middleware
The JWT already carried a `tier` claim but nothing on the server read it
— AuthGate enforcement was client-only, so a valid JWT could hit paid
LLM/research endpoints regardless of the user's access tier.

- shared-hono authMiddleware now extracts `tier` into `c.userTier`,
  defaulting unknown/missing claims to `public` (never silently grants
  higher access).
- New `requireTier(minTier)` middleware + `hasTier`/`getTierLevel`
  helpers. Tier hierarchy (guest < public < beta < alpha < founder) is
  mirrored locally to avoid pulling the Svelte-facing shared-branding
  package into Bun services.
- Applied `requireTier('beta')` as defense-in-depth on resource-heavy
  apps/api modules (chat, context, food, guides, news-research, picture,
  plants, research, traces, who) and the MCP endpoint. Pure CRUD modules
  stay auth-only — access there is gated by ownership, not tier.
- DEV_BYPASS_AUTH now injects `userTier` (defaults to founder, override
  via DEV_USER_TIER).
- Authentication guideline documents the pattern + test suite covers
  hierarchy, passes-at-minimum, and rejection paths.

eaf97aeebf fix(api): unblock tsc by dropping rootDir and allowing .ts imports
Running pnpm type-check inside apps/api failed before any real
error could run, blocked by two structural errors: drizzle.presi.config.ts
and scripts/generate-who-dossiers.ts are deliberately outside src/
but are matched by the include pattern, tripping TS6059 against
rootDir=src. And @mana/shared-types imports peer files with explicit
.ts extensions, which needs allowImportingTsExtensions under
moduleResolution=bundler.

Remove rootDir (we're noEmit anyway — Bun runs src/index.ts
directly, tsc is only a lint pass), drop the unused outDir, add
noEmit explicitly, and enable allowImportingTsExtensions. Type-check
now completes cleanly.

55bf493f44 fix(api): set supportsStructuredOutputs=true on mana-llm provider
generateObject() in the AI SDK falls back to a tool-call mode when the
provider doesn't advertise structured-output support — and tool calling
through Ollama isn't reliable enough that the schema-validation step
passes. The response was failing with 'No object generated: response
did not match schema' even though the underlying mana-llm + Ollama
roundtrip works correctly when called with response_format directly
(verified via curl).

Set supportsStructuredOutputs:true on the createOpenAICompatible
factory so the AI SDK uses response_format json_schema mode. mana-llm
already routes that to Ollama's native format field thanks to the
companion fix in services/mana-llm/src/providers/ollama.py — verified
end-to-end with the MealAnalysisSchema and Gemma 3 4B.

3ccfc3be99 fix(api): correct mana-llm path prefix and model name in vision routes
Found while smoke-testing the AI SDK refactor: both nutriphi and planta
were calling `${MANA_LLM_URL}/api/v1/chat/completions` and passing
`gemini-2.0-flash` as the model name. Both wrong:

  1. mana-llm exposes routes under /v1/, not /api/v1/. The original
     pre-refactor code had the same bug — it predates this commit and
     was apparently never noticed because the photo workflow was never
     wired into the unified app's UI until last week. /api/v1 returned
     404 against the live mana-llm container; now we hit /v1.

  2. mana-llm's router parses model strings as `provider/model`
     (services/mana-llm/src/providers/router.py:_parse_model). Without
     a prefix, `gemini-2.0-flash` was being routed as
     `ollama/gemini-2.0-flash` and only worked via the auto-fallback
     to Google when ollama failed. Be explicit: `google/gemini-2.0-flash`
     hits the Google provider directly and skips the failed-ollama
     round-trip.

VISION_MODEL env var still wins over the default, so prod overrides
remain possible.

9d1b25130d fix(api/who): server-side validation of [IDENTITY_REVEALED] sentinel
The user asked "bist du kopernikus?" while playing Galileo. The
LLM correctly responded "Kopernikus? ... aber nicht meiner!" — and
then appended [IDENTITY_REVEALED] anyway. Game flipped to "won
in 2 messages" with Galileo's name revealed, even though the
guess was wrong.

This is gemma3:4b being lazy about the sentinel rule: any time the
user says "bist du <name>?", the model is biased toward emitting
the sentinel because the prompt mentions "errät den Namen". Weaker
LLMs in general struggle to follow strict negative instructions
when the trigger word is right there in the input.

Fix in three layers:

1. Server-side validation (the real safety net). When the LLM
   emits [IDENTITY_REVEALED], independently verify that the user's
   CURRENT message contains the canonical character name (or one
   of its significant parts) using the same matchesName helper
   the explicit /guess endpoint uses. If the LLM emitted but the
   user didn't actually name this character, strip the sentinel,
   log a who.sentinel_false_positive, and treat the reply as a
   normal turn. The legit cases — user actually said the right
   name — still flow through cleanly.

2. matchesName improvements. The previous logic only matched a
   single-word guess against name parts; "bist du leonardo?" would
   fall through and miss a real win. Rewritten to:
     a) exact normalized match
     b) guess contains the full name as substring
     c) guess contains any significant name part as a WHOLE WORD
   Plus a Set for the guessWords lookup so it's O(1) per part.

3. Tighter system prompt. Added explicit "Sentinel-Regel" section
   with two FALSCH examples ("bist du Tesla?" while playing Edison,
   "bist du ein Erfinder?") and two KORREKT examples. Doesn't fix
   the false-positive rate at the model level but reduces it.

Layer 1 is the load-bearing one — even if the LLM emits the
sentinel for the wrong reason, the server gates the reveal on
ground truth.

0c0e31d2f3 refactor(api): use Vercel AI SDK + Zod for nutriphi/planta vision routes
Replaces hand-rolled fetch + JSON.parse + cast-to-any with generateObject
from the AI SDK. The model is constrained to the shared Zod schemas in
@mana/shared-types, so the response is validated at the boundary instead
of trusting Gemini to emit the right shape.

Routes refactored:
  - nutriphi/analysis/photo  (image_url → multimodal `image:` content)
  - nutriphi/analysis/text   (free-text meal description)
  - planta/analysis/identify (plant photo identification)

Why this is materially better than the old code:

  - Runtime validation: if Gemini drifts, the AI SDK throws before the
    response leaves the route. Frontend never sees malformed payloads.
  - Provider-portable: createOpenAICompatible({ baseURL: MANA_LLM_URL })
    keeps mana-llm as the central routing/auth/observability point. The
    AI SDK speaks the OpenAI dialect to mana-llm. If we ever swap the
    backend (e.g. claude-sonnet-4-6 for plant ID), it's a one-line model
    name change.
  - System prompts moved from a multi-line example-laden string to a
    short instruction. The schema itself (with .describe() field hints)
    now carries the structural contract that the JSON-by-example
    paragraph used to encode. Token cost goes down, accuracy goes up.
  - Drops manual fetch error handling (status checks, JSON.parse, cast)
    in favour of try/catch around generateObject. Errors are typed.

mana-llm itself is unchanged — it's still the OpenAI-compatible proxy
in front of Gemini Vision. The AI SDK just gives us a typed client and
a schema-aware decoder on top of it.
